三种方式都是一键搭建php开发环境

三种方式前提都是在linux下 wamp和phpstudy就不再用了

首先打造linux开发环境,通过vagrant+vbox实现本地文件同步到虚拟机上进行同步开发 具体文档参考

https://www.cnblogs.com/php-linux/p/5262077.html

1.使用lnmp一键安装包

https://lnmp.org/

相当简单,用了几年了

安装一个命令就搞定 接下来选择各种版本就行了

安装好后,还可以升级 修改php版本等,可以安装redis 各种扩展

wget http://soft.vpser.net/lnmp/lnmp1.6.tar.gz -cO lnmp1.6.tar.gz && tar zxf lnmp1.6.tar.gz && cd lnmp1.6 && ./install.sh lnmp

2 使用dnmp 

docker+nginx+mysql+php

首先得在linux里面安装docker和docker-composer

https://www.cnblogs.com/php-linux/p/11543237.html

https://www.cnblogs.com/php-linux/p/10496478.html

接着自己搭建太麻烦了,使用别人弄好的 github地址

https://github.com/yeszao/dnmp  这个目录清晰

执行docker-composer up 就能安装,配置也是在目录外面就能搞定 也挺好用

3.是以前就听过的宝塔linux

https://www.bt.cn/download/linux.html  软件地址

以前安装后,会给一个ip,让登陆,我一直登陆不了,以为要线上服务器才能用,后来把他提示的ip换成本地的,发现挺好用的,

不研究linux 可以界面就搞定,当然这个是linux比较熟悉的前提下,懒人使用这个,遇到不能解决的,还是得回归到linux命令行操作

最新文章

  1. 如何利用word2013写图文并茂的博客
  2. 前后端分离开发——模拟数据mock.js
  3. 基于spring-boot的web应用,ckeditor上传文件图片文件
  4. 开发工具 之 PowerDesigner
  5. “==”,比较的是引用 “equals方法”比较的是具体内容
  6. first blood暴力搜索,剪枝是关键
  7. Primefaces的fileUpload组件使用
  8. Problem E: Erratic Ants
  9. spring.net中间IoC、DI和MVC
  10. Js 作用域与作用域链与执行上下文不得不说的故事 ⁄(⁄ ⁄•⁄ω⁄•⁄ ⁄)⁄
  11. Python基础学习参考(六):列表和元组
  12. [微信JSSDK] 解决SDK注入权限验证 安卓正常,IOS出现config fail
  13. Tomcat的缺省是多少,怎么修改
  14. 基于后端云的Android注册登录开发
  15. 移动端rem计算
  16. HDU 1003 Max Sum 求区间最大值 (尺取法)
  17. Oracle 11.2.0.4 RAC重建EM案例
  18. 【Revit API】墙体分割
  19. java.security.NoSuchAlgorithmException: SHA1PRNG SecureRandom not available
  20. asp.net Hessian 服务的注册

热门文章

  1. java 的守护进程脚本
  2. redhat quay 集成镜像构建
  3. Linux提高工作效率的命令
  4. ZROI1119 【十一·联考】幸福
  5. Spring Cloud 升级最新 Greenwich 版本,舒服了~
  6. atlassian-confluence - docker安装
  7. Java编程思想之十 内部类
  8. ASP.NET Core Windows服务开发技术实战演练
  9. selenium爬虫入门(selenium+Java+chrome)
  10. Isilon的WebUI上指定跨时区时间的小问题